The Best Kept Secret in Private Plates

Northern Irish registrations follow their own format: three letters always containing an I or a Z for the issuing area, followed by up to four numbers, in shapes like ABZ 1234 or XIA 21.

Two things make them special. First, they carry no age identifier at all, so like dateless plates they can be assigned to any vehicle of any age and reveal nothing about when the car was registered. Second, they remain the most affordable corner of the entire market, with clean marks starting at prices that would barely buy dinner elsewhere in the hobby.

Northern Irish Plates FAQ

Can I use a Northern Irish plate in England, Scotland or Wales?

Yes, completely. Northern Irish registrations are standard UK marks and can be assigned to any vehicle registered anywhere in the United Kingdom. Thousands of mainland drivers run them for exactly the reasons on this page.

Do NI plates really hide a car's age?

Yes. They carry no age identifier, so nothing on the plate dates the vehicle. The registration document still records the car's true year, as with any registration, but the plate itself gives nothing away.

Why do NI plates always contain an I or a Z?

The letters identify the Northern Irish issuing area, and every NI mark carries at least one of them. It is also the quiet superpower of the format: names and initials needing an I, impossible on current style plates, work perfectly here.

Why are Northern Irish plates so cheap?

Supply is generous relative to mainland demand, and many buyers simply have not discovered the format. The result is dateless style benefits at entry level prices, which is why value focused buyers and fleets start here.

Is the transfer process any different?

No. The same DVLA assignment process applies and we handle all of it, usually within days. The only difference is one rule you can ignore: with no age identifier, the plate can never make your car look too new.
